Events in Music History in 1943

Ellington's Carnegie Debut

Jan 23 Duke Ellington plays at Carnegie Hall in New York City for the first time

Sinatra's Debut

Feb 6 Singer Frank Sinatra debuts on radio's "Your Hit Parade"

Tagus River Plane Crash

Feb 22 Plane crash in the Tagus River, Lisbon, Portugal kills 23 with 15 survivors including singer Jane Froman

  • Mar 31 Rodgers & Hammerstein's musical "Oklahoma!" opens at the St. James Theatre, NYC; runs for 2,212 performances
  • Apr 28 1st performance of Marc Blitzstein's "Freedom Morning"

Present Laughter

Apr 29 Noël Coward's comic play "Present Laughter" premieres in London

  • Apr 30 Noël Coward's play "This Happy Breed" premieres in London; written in 1939, production was delayed by WWII

The Eve of St Mark

Jun 26 Maxwell Anderson's stage drama "The Eve of St Mark" closes at the Cort Theatre, NYC, after 307 performances

Stormy Weather

Jul 21 Musical film "Stormy Weather", directed by Andrew L. Stone, starring Bill Robinson, Lena Horne and Fats Waller (singing "Ain't Misbehavin'") premieres in the US

Music Premiere

Aug 11 Richard Strauss' Second Horn Concerto, premieres at the Salzburg Festival with Gottfried von Freiberg as soloist with the Vienna Philharmonic under Karl Böhm

  • Oct 7 Weill, Perelman and Nash' musical "One Touch of Venus" premieres in NYC

Music History

Oct 19 Theater Guild presentation of Shakespeare's "Othello", starring Paul Robeson, opens at the Shubert Theater, NYC; runs for 296 performances

Music Premiere

Nov 3 Dmitri Shostakovich's 8th Symphony premieres in Moscow

  • Nov 6 "Catulli Carmina (Songs of Catullus)", the second work of Carl Orff's Trionfi cantata trilogy premieres at the Leipzig Opera

Girl Crazy

Nov 26 MGM releases last of 9 Judy Garland-Mickey Rooney movies - "Girl Crazy", a film adaptation of George Gershwin and Ira Gershwin's stage musical

Requiem

Dec 3 Howard Hanson conducts premiere of his 4th Symphony ("Requiem") with the Boston Symphony; wins Pulitzer Prize for Music, 1944

  • Dec 20 "Internationale" is no longer used as USSR National Anthem
  • Dec 23 Engelbert Humperdinck's "Hansel & Gretel" becomes 1st complete opera to be telecast (WGRB, Schenectady, New York)
